Title: Scheduler double-waters bed 3 after DST shift

New folks: the Verdella scheduler stores watering slots in local time. After the clock change, slot 06:00 fires twice, soaking the herb bed. Fix: store UTC, convert at display. Repro on the Oakhollow test rig only. To reproduce, install the firmware identified by the token below.

build token for hafop-kahog: htk31_a432ac515d5bb1362002c1e1a7e80ef

### Action Item: Spoolhaven Retry Storm

From last Tuesday's outage: the Spoolhaven print service retried failed jobs without backoff, saturating the render pool. Fix merged; retries now use capped exponential backoff with jitter. Owner will monitor for a week before closing. The agreed retry constants are recorded below.

constants for yadup-kajof:
RATE_LIMITS = {
    "zorwyn": 1,
    "druwyn": 1,
}

Ticket #2087 — Signature verification failure after payroll export format change

Reviewer: the WageStream exporter began failing signature checks after we switched from the legacy fixed-width payroll format to the new columnar layout. The manifest hash now covers the schema descriptor, but the verifier still expects the old digest ordering. Patch attached corrects the canonicalization step; please confirm before merge. Artifacts were re-signed with the key below.

rollout seal: bky9_PeXH1fTLY

# Tile cache layer for the Marrowpoint map renderer.
# Security folks: cache keys include the auth scope, so tiles
# rendered for one tenant can't be served to another. Eviction
# is LRU with a hard byte cap — no unbounded growth, promise.
# Don't loosen the TTLs without a review. Constants are below.

limits module of tafop-hahop:
WEIGHTS = {
    "julmir": 223,
    "belox": 987,
    "lamion": 470,
    "pelath": 609,
    "fraok": 1010,
    "eliion": 343,
    "drudor": 342,
}